Have you ever been summoned with a subpoena to court? With not one but a 
battery of prosecuting attorneys inquiring into intimate details of your life?

 

The word “subpoena” doesn’t appear in the Bible but the idea is in 2 
Corinthians 5:10: “We must all appear before the judgment seat of Christ; that 
every one may receive the things done in his body, according to that he hath 
done, whether it be good or bad.” The next verse speaks of “the terror of the 
Lord.” Rather frightening!

 

Dial Daily Bread is devoted to telling Good News, but this sounds like Bad 
News. Jesus says, “There is nothing covered that shall not be revealed; and 
hid, that shall not be known” (Matt. 10:26). But that verse itself is Good 
News, for He adds, “Fear them not therefore,” that is, don’t be afraid of your 
prosecutors (or your persecutors!). Why? Because in that appearance before “the 
judgment seat of Christ” He will be your Friend, not your Enemy if today you 
will simply LET Him.

 

(1) The Father Himself refuses to condemn you (see John 5:22). (2) Jesus also 
refused to condemn anyone in that day (see John 12:47, 48). (3) Therefore the 
only “condemnation” will come from what is written of “the things done in the 
body,” a record that is indisputable, recorded not only in the “books” of 
heaven, but in your own soul as well. Jesus won’t have to say a word; the 
“book” will be open. Paul says, “Some men’s sins are open beforehand, going 
before to judgment; and some men they follow after” (1 Tim. 5:24).

 

The Good News is: even though there are shameful things you don’t want opened 
up, you can “send them on beforehand to judgment.” You can get on your knees 
and confess them to your Savior, you can even let bitter tears fall; the Holy 
Spirit can teach your sinful heart to hate those sins; your heart can be truly 
converted; you can be a new person; you can believe the promise, “If we confess 
our sins, He is faithful and just to forgive us our sins, and to cleanse us 
from all unrighteousness” (1 John 1:9).
